Job description

About Bland

We’re a Series C startup that has raised over $100M from Emergence Capital, Scale Venture Partners, Y Combinator, and the founders of PayPal and Twilio.

Our mission is to build the world’s most human AI phone agents. Thousands of businesses rely on Bland AI to automate customer conversations while delivering an experience customers actually enjoy.

Voice AI is a nascent space with no established design conventions. The patterns that define how people build, configure, and interact with AI agents are being written right now by a small number of companies, including us. We have a strong, creative brand and a rapidly expanding product surface.

The role

You’d own how the product looks and how it behaves: the interaction model, the visual language, and the design system that establishes both in the codebase.

You’d work day to day with our lead designer and PM. They live in product direction and there’s no shortage of opinion there, so you won’t be starting from a blank page on what to build. This role is responsible for how users interact with the product and how it looks when it ships. This role reports to our Design Lead.

What you’d own
  • The design system. Architecture, components, and motion. You should be familiar with design.md files and enforcing usage in an AI-driven environment.

  • Interaction design for major surfaces, from how something should behave through the shipped UI.

  • Establishing the product’s visual direction and evolving it as the product surfaces expand.

  • Pushing PRs of frontend polish in the codebase (don’t worry, we’re very AI-friendly).

  • Contribute to solving product problems with the lead designer and PM, then taking the craft the rest of the way.

What you’d be designing

Customers use our dashboard to build, test, evaluate, and run LLM voice agents. Behavior gets configured instead of scripted, none of the outputs are deterministic. Our users are technical and non-technical, from CIOs and call center experts to our in-house FDE team.

We’re most of the way through a ground-up redesign of the dashboard and we’ll be landing it in the next quarter, so this role will be a major contributor early and meaningfully.

How we work
  • Opening a PR in the morning and merging it that afternoon is completely normal, and it’s one of the better things about working here.

  • Priorities move around. You might start the week on one surface and spend Wednesday somewhere else, and you’ll usually have three or more things going at once.

  • That pace depends on AI tools. Running several Claude sessions at once to keep your PRs moving is an ordinary day around here, and we expect you to keep pushing on how you work.

  • The bar is high and we’re not shy about it. We want the design held to the same standard as the model: good enough that other people in voice AI look at what we ship and copy it.

What we’re looking for

Visual work that stands on its own. We want to open your portfolio, look at something you shipped, and be genuinely impressed. You have opinions about how software should look in the age of generative design.

A design system you built that made it into production. A clean Figma library matters less to us than how it was adopted and used in a product.

Real depth in interaction design. Snappy hover state animations, what happens in the gap between a click and a result, how a dense table behaves while it’s loading or empty or wrong.

Comfortability with AI coding tools. You aren’t afraid to implement frontend polish.

4+ years shipping web products, including time as the designer at an early-stage B2B SaaS company. You’ve worked on hard surfaces: data-heavy dashboards, workflow tools, anything where the user configures behavior instead of filling in fields.

Curiosity about the product itself. You ask engineers how things work, you want to know how the agents behave a level below the screens, and you go get that context rather than waiting for it in a ticket. We’re a lean team and each of us needs to know the product well enough to prioritize which features get built or not.

Fluency with current tools. Figma mastery is assumed. Past that, you’re using Weave, Flora, or whatever comes after them, along with modern prototyping tools, as part of how you normally work.

Bonus
  • Brand-level thinking—Product has the opportunity to both work with and make changes to our brand.

  • Motion or generative visual work

  • Ability to write coherent FE code
